Dola at a glance

Dola is a village of 336 people in 71 households (Census 2011) in Chakisain tehsil, Pauri Garhwal district, Uttarakhand, the 40th-largest of 115 villages in Chakisain tehsil. Literacy is 65%, 6 points above the tehsil average of 59% and the sex ratio is 1,182 women per 1,000 men. It lies 69 km from the Pauri Garhwal district centre, 33 km from Kafara, the nearest town, 19 km from Ramnagar railway station (straight-line distances). The pincode is 246123, served by Chipalghat (A) post office; the LGD village code is 46454. The nearest hospital or health centre is Dr. Bhatts Clinic, 15 km away. The village votes in Srinagar assembly constituency, represented by MLA Dr. Dhan Singh Rawat. The population is estimated at 396 in 2026, up 18% since the 2011 Census.
